The Normanskill Farm
The Normanskill Farm is located in Albany, NY. It was a historic dairy farm dating back to the early 1800s, established with the founding of Normansville.
Today, the farm is home to the Albany Mounted Unit's horses, cows, and a winter home for our flock. It also has community gardens and a dog park.
It is also home to our Brother Yusuf Memorial Garden, a shared space with the Radix Center and other organizations. Friends of Tivoli Lake Preserve and Farm helped tend to this garden space from 2020 to 2025, but as of 2026, we will focus our garden efforts at Tivoli.
